Smart Groups 👥

EcoSend Automations are powered by Smart Groups in your Contacts section, which update in real-time.

Your messages are triggered when a contact enters a Smart Group or exists a Smart Group.

Smart Group Triggers

In Contacts you can group users based on:

  • Their online activity, such as the number of times they have visited your platform or logged-into your app

  • User properties (attributes), such as location, or company name, company position.

  • Message behaviour Segmentation, such as which contacts have opened your recent email campaigns, or which email addresses recently bounced.

Create a group by saving any combination of filters, such as 'Last seen online 2 weeks ago' AND 'Company Industry contains Sustainability'.

These real time updates can be used to trigger Automated Messages. Send a message when a user...

  • Enters a Smart Group – when a new user matches the filters

  • Exits a Smart Group – when an existing user stops matching the filters

Building your Automation 🛠️

Once you've created your Smart Group and rules for entry, it's time to build out your Automation 🎉

You can select between one-off Automated Messages, or Sequences. Automated Messages are one-off events, while Sequences send a series of messages.

Give your Automation a Name and purpose so you can reference back to it later on. Then select the relevant Smart Group as the trigger to fire the Automation(s).

Messaging Options

EcoSend gives you a range of message options, to ensure you hit your recipients in exactly the right format. Choose between:

  • In-app only

    These are best for messaging users when they are already online. Retain their engagement on your platform by triggering in-app
    nudges to celebrate their first milestones and nudge them to activate additional features or check out other ares of your site.

  • In-app & Email
    Combine both and send via in-app and email simultaneously.

  • Simple Email
    Give recipients a sense of 1-2-1 outreach with a Simple Email. These work best for 'personal' outreach from a particular agent, such as
    re-engaging cold leads, or requesting a Case Study from a super-user.

  • HTML
    Craft aesthetic, long-form HTML emails with the EcoSend Visual Editor. No knowledge of HTML required! Use our drag & drop functionality
    to create Newsletters, Product Updates, Event announcements and more!

Adding Variables 👋

When creating a message in EcoSend, you can add a Variable by typing “{{” to bring up the Variable picker.

You can also insert a Variable by hitting the “Insert” button to bring up the Insert menu, or by highlighting a piece of text and choosing “Add a Variable” from the inline menu.

In the variable picker, you can choose from any properties or events you’re tracking against your contacts in GoSquared, such as 'First Name',
'Company Industry', etc.

Selecting the Variable in your message will bring up the Variable options panel where you can change the Variable, and set a fallback.

To add a Variable in HTML, you will need to write-out your selected Variable.

For example, if you viewed the ‘First Name’ Variable from the drop-down picker, you would need to type-out {{ first_name }} in HTML.
